8.3.2.2 Text messages
The GSM dialer can manage eight alarm messages (SMS) of up to 40
characters and send them to mobile phones.
The “Site” message with time and date is transferred automatically when the
GSM dialer sends a text message. A site message usually sends details of the
site itself (e.g. address, contact details etc.).
